FEATURES
APPLICATIONS
♦ Digital sensors
♦ Light barriers
♦ Configurable high-side, low-side and push-pull operation
♦ Current limited output (< 450 mA)
♦ Proximity switches
♦ Reverse polarity protection
♦ 150 mA output current
♦ 5 µs input filter for spike supression
♦ Wide supply voltage range from 8 to 30 V
♦ Driver shut-down with over temperature
♦ Integrated free-wheeling diode for inductive loads
♦ Sensor supply voltage output of 5 V, 10 mA

The iC-DX can be operated in high-side, low-side and
push-pull switch mode. Figure 4 shows the high-side
operation where IN pin must be kept high and the OE
pin controls the switch. Figure 5 shows the low-side
operation where IN pin must be kept low and the OE
pin controls the switch. Figure 6 shows the push-pull
operation where OE pin must be kept high and the IN
pin controls the switch.

The iC-DX has a built-in spurious pulse suppression
that prevents short (undesired) pulses at the input pins
from reaching the output. Every pulse at OE or IN
pins shorter than 1.6 µs (cf. Electrical Characteristics
No. 306) will be ignored and the output will not re-
act. The minimum required pulse length to be sure
that the output reacts is 4 µs (cf. Electrical Characteris-
tics No. 307). That means that every pulse longer than
4 µs will be propagated to the output but with an addi-
tional propagation delay of 1.2 µs maximum. The re-
sulting maximum propagation delay is 5.2 µs (cf. Elec-
trical Characteristics No. 305).
